0.0625 moles of methane is burnt in air according to the following equation:
CH4 + 2O2 → CO2 + 2H2O
How many moles of Oxygen are required for this combustion reaction?
0.03125
0.0625
0.125
0.25

Assuming that all the chemicals involved in the reaction are in the gaseous state, the balanced symbol equation is:
CH4 + 2O2 → CO2 + 2H2O
What is the total volume of the gas produced when 2500 cm3 of methane is burned?
2500 cm3
5000 cm3
7500 cm3
1000 cm3

Which one of the following pairs of atoms is most likely to form an ionic bond?
Na and F
C and F
N and F
O and F

Which of the following statement is incorrect?
the greater the number of electrons in a molecule, the greater the van der Waals forces
the layers in graphite are held together by Van der Waals forces
the boiling point of noble gases increases down the group
Water has a higher than expected boiling point because of intermolecular hydrogen bond
